      Just wanted to add my 2 cents as well as this seems to be recently for me. I've updated to recent on Opera and Opera Beta.

      Problem is seen for me when I already have tabs open. When I select on a URL or linked text that I want to open into a new tab, then select the new tab, Opera closes fully. If I re-open Opera, the previous tabs are there, however doing this same process again, Opera will crash then all my opened tabs I had opened are now gone upon the next launch opening of Opera. Kind of annoying having to manually re-open tabs since I usually have about 20 tabs going.

                    We've found the cause of this bug. A fix will be available soon. Thanks to all of you!

                    If you can't wait a few days, and you'd like to work around this issue, try Opera -> Preferences, then click Browser, and deselect "Enable the search pop-up when selecting text". This disables the selection pop-up (which is the cause of this bug), you can turn it back on once you get an update with the fix. Of course not using Ctrl+Click as advised above will also work around the issue.
